    Will Battlefield 2 run on my computer?

    I have just bought a new laptop, and i have attempted to install Battlefield 2, however, when i try to run the game, it begins to load and then disappears never to return again.

    I have an Acer laptop with the following spec:

    Windows Vista Home Premium
    1.6GHz Dual Core Processer
    1 GB Ram
    Intel Graphics Media Accelerator 950
    120GB HDD

    I didn't think there would be any problems with it as the computer seems clearly big enough to run the game. Any suggestions would prove very helpful

      Re: Will Battlefield 2 run on my computer?

      no it wouldn't the game does not support intel graphics
